The verdict

Stepping Stone runs at 59% of its industry's injury rate - safer than the typical 623220 Residential Mental Health and Substance Abuse Facilities workplace, earning a grade B.

Stepping Stone: 2.2 TCR = 59% of 623220 Residential Mental Health and Substance Abuse Facilities BLS 3.8 · 9y Form 300A (see methodology below)

Year-by-Year Safety Data

Year TCR DART Injuries Illnesses Fatalities
2024 0.0 0.0 0 0 0
2023 4.5 0.0 2 0 0
2022 2.3 0.0 1 0 0
2021 2.5 2.5 0 1 0
2020 2.5 2.5 0 1 0
2019 2.8 0.0 1 0 0
2018 2.6 2.6 1 0 0
2017 2.7 2.7 1 0 0
2016 0.0 0.0 0 0 0
